Debt-to-Equity ratio measures a company's financial leverage by comparing its total debt to shareholder equity. A lower D/E ratio generally indicates a more financially stable company with less risk.
The latest debt-to-equity ratio for FBIO is 0.36. That is above the Healthcare sector average of 0.31. Investors often review this figure alongside Fortress Biotech's historical trend and sector peers before judging valuation or financial health.
Against Healthcare companies, FBIO currently prints 0.36 for debt-to-equity ratio, while the sector average sits near 0.31. That is roughly 15.6% above the sector mean. Large gaps often invite a closer look at Fortress Biotech's growth, margins, and balance sheet.
